The Scientific Research Behind the Sinclair Approach



The Sinclair Technique is based in strenuous clinical research study, providing a comprehensive understanding of the neurobiological devices underlying alcoholism and its therapy - Sinclair Method UK. This innovative approach to alcoholism recovery is based upon the principle of medicinal extinction, which includes making use of an opioid antagonist drug called naltrexone. Naltrexone jobs by obstructing the brain's opioid receptors, which are associated with the support and incentive paths connected with alcohol consumption


The neurobiological systems underlying alcohol addiction include the release of endorphins and dopamine in action to alcohol consumption, leading to pleasant feelings and reinforcing the wish to continue drinking. Over time, this reinforcement results in the development of compulsive alcohol-seeking habits and addiction.


The Sinclair Approach uses naltrexone to interrupt this support procedure. By blocking the opioid receptors, naltrexone reduces the release of endorphins and dopamine, consequently diminishing the enjoyable impacts of alcohol. Consequently, the mind's reward system is progressively retrained, leading to a decrease in alcohol cravings and usage.




Countless scientific researches have actually provided evidence for the effectiveness of the Sinclair Approach in lowering alcohol intake and promoting long-term abstaining. This study sustains the idea that alcohol addiction is a treatable medical problem, and that pharmacological treatments, such as the Sinclair Method, can play an important duty in accomplishing effective recuperation.


Understanding Naltrexone and Its Role in Healing



Naltrexone plays an essential function in alcohol addiction recovery by interfering with the reinforcement procedure and reducing desires for alcohol. Naltrexone is a medicine that comes from a class of medications called opioid receptor antagonists. It works by obstructing the results of endorphins, which are normally produced in the body and add to the pleasant feelings related to alcohol consumption alcohol.


In the context of the Sinclair Method, naltrexone is taken one hour before consuming alcohol. By obstructing the endorphin release, naltrexone interrupts the reinforcement procedure that occurs when alcohol is taken in. This interruption weakens the organization between alcohol and pleasurable sensations, ultimately decreasing the desire to consume.


Additionally, naltrexone has actually been found to minimize cravings for alcohol by acting on the mind's reward system. It binds to the opioid receptors, protecting against the launch of d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with sensations of enjoyment and benefit. By decreasing the dopamine release, naltrexone assists to reduce the food craving for alcohol.


It is very important to keep in mind that naltrexone needs to be used as component of a thorough therapy prepare for alcohol addiction, consisting of treatment and support. While naltrexone can be an effective tool in reducing alcohol desires and advertising recuperation, it is not a standalone service. Specialist support and ongoing assistance are essential for successful long-term recovery.


How the Sinclair Technique Works to Lower Alcohol Cravings



The Sinclair Approach operates by making use of the medicine naltrexone to efficiently decrease yearnings for alcohol. Naltrexone is an opioid receptor villain that works by obstructing the impacts of endorphins, which are launched in reaction to alcohol consumption. By obstructing these endorphins, naltrexone helps to interfere with the enhancing cycle of alcoholism.


When taken as recommended, normally one hour before drinking alcohol, naltrexone aids to decrease the pleasurable effects of alcohol. It does this by blocking the opioid receptors in the brain, which are accountable for the blissful and fulfilling feelings associated with alcohol consumption. Because of this, the desire to proceed alcohol consumption and the desires for alcohol are diminished.


The Sinclair Technique is distinct in that it does not call for abstinence or complete cessation of alcohol consumption - Sinclair Method UK. Rather, it concentrates on reducing the compulsive and irrepressible desires for alcohol that typically cause too much alcohol consumption. By progressively minimizing the incentive and support related to alcohol, the Sinclair Method aims to assist people reclaim control over their drinking routines and inevitably minimize or eliminate their alcohol consumption


It is necessary to note that the Sinclair Technique need to always be utilized under the support of a healthcare expert, as they can give the necessary assistance and monitor the individual's progress throughout the therapy process.

Exploring the Long-Term Perks of the Sinclair Approach



One of the essential elements of the Sinclair Method is its capability to give lasting advantages for people recouping from alcohol dependency. This innovative treatment strategy, developed by Dr. David Sinclair, concentrates on using medicine to lower the desires and pleasure related to alcohol usage. By doing so, it aids people restore control over their drinking behaviors and inevitably leads to sustained recuperation.




The long-term advantages of the Sinclair Method are multifaceted. First of all, it uses a more personalized and flexible method to recuperation compared to conventional methods. As opposed to needing full abstinence, the Sinclair Technique permits people to proceed drinking while gradually decreasing their alcohol consumption. This method can be especially useful for those that deal with the idea of offering up alcohol totally.




Furthermore, the Sinclair Method has revealed promising cause preventing relapse. By targeting the brain's benefit system, the medication used in this strategy helps to re-shape neural pathways connected with alcohol dependency. This causes a reduced wish to consume and a reduced danger of relapse in the lengthy run.


In Addition, the Sinclair Method advertises self-awareness and equips individuals to take control of their healing journey. By actively taking look at these guys part in the treatment process and tracking their progression, people can obtain a deeper understanding of their drinking patterns and sets off. This self-awareness is important for preventing future regressions and maintaining lasting soberness.
